Former senator Raul Roco would have turned 73 last Sunday, October 23, if he did not succumb to prostate cancer in 2005. Considered by those close to him as “the best president we never had,” Roco laid down the groundwork for the Comprehensive Agrarian Reform Program in the House of Representatives. When he became senator, he authored important bills on lifting the ban on political advertisements, allowing overseas Filipino workers to vote, and the Anti-Sexual Harassment Law.
